Transaction 21a03dc99d46d01a63cb386662a737393bd439bf3a3ac22d748a943c88114162
1 Input
1 Output
-
21a03dc99d46d01a63cb386662a737393bd439bf3a3ac22d748a943c88114162:0
- value
- 338116
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14e889efbe54773eb883b898d3332cb85f798339 OP_EQUAL
- address
- 33ba1TfBWhfc3Xf4THeXePhZKaXszoohh7